Transaction 58b789952f98af95876077f523eb87f3e3a008d72d177dacfe725c81bf6021e4
1 Input
1 Output
-
58b789952f98af95876077f523eb87f3e3a008d72d177dacfe725c81bf6021e4:0
- value
- 42782255
- script pubkey
- OP_0 OP_PUSHBYTES_20 150a474aae4394fb6c6f4dc42289d4485f44ce36
- address
- bc1qz59ywj4wgw20kmr0fhzz9zw5fp05fn3kgey2dp